Does Mexico Have States Like the United States and How Many States Does Mexico Have?

June 27, 2020 by Karen Hill

Mexico has 31 states and a federal district, Mexico City, which is the capital.

Mexico, Central America, and the West Indies are home to numerous different languages and cultures.

Many countries are former colonies of Great Britain, France, Spain, or Holland.

Mexico has a population of about 111 million people, and is the fifth-largest country in the Americas by total area.

The 14th largest independent nation in the world, Mexico is considered a newly industrialized country, and its economy is strongly linked to the United States.

Mexico has a rich history with numerous ancient civilizations, and boasts a long tradition in the arts, culture, and renowned cuisine.
